The Ring Security System
Ring offers everything you need to create a smart, safe, and secure home. Their system consists of video doorbells, security cameras, security systems, security lighting, and more.
Video doorbells come in wired and battery solutions and can be hardwired into your existing doorbell. When someone comes to your door, these smart devices detect their presence and send a notification to your mobile device. Not only can you see who’s at your door with clarity, but you can also have a two-way conversation.
Ring IQ enables the cameras to recognize packages and people, alerting you should either appear. Did a stranger pick up a package left by your front door? Let them know they’re on camera. Indoor & Outdoor Security Cameras
Many of our clients appreciate Ring’s compact interior cameras. These cameras help you monitor what’s happening in your home when you’re away. Should your fur baby decide to chew up a tennis shoe, you can let them know they’ve been spotted and see their little ears perk up in surprise.
Ring’s outdoor security cameras offer corner-to-corner coverage of your property and come with lights and built-in sirens. These cameras take action if a security event unfolds, illuminating the area of movement and setting off the alarm, potentially scaring away intruders.
Ring Alarm
Ring’s alarm system integrates with sensors and cameras. Whether movement is detected by the back door, smoke is coming from the kitchen, or someone tries to open a window, you’ll know. Not only does it send you an alert, but you can also opt for professional monitoring, ensuring someone reaches out to emergency personnel should you require assistance. You can look at the live video feed to determine the correct action, and if an emergency arises, press the app's SOS button to request emergency support.
Did you forget to arm your alarm before you left? You can perform this task right from the Ring app on your smartphone.

Keep Your System Functioning Smoothly
Eero's mesh Wi-Fi system blankets your home with fast and secure Wi-Fi. It also offers Wi-Fi 7 technology, the latest standard that provides blazing-fast speeds and improved connectivity. With this high-tech, reliable internet, you can count on your Ring Security System to work as it should every time.
The Ring Alarm Pro also acts as an Eero Wi-Fi extender, providing backup internet if your internet or power goes down.
The Cost
With all its features, you would expect Ring to fall into the pricey range. Compared to traditional security systems, it is far less expensive. Yearly subscription plans range from $50 to $200.
